Thin-film windows for XRF sample cups

Thin-film support windows are a crucial sealing component of XRF sample cups—disposable plastic containers used for sampling liquids and powders. These windows must be transparent to all signals produced by the analytes of interest and chemically compatible with the sample. Fabricated and stored under environmentally controlled conditions to prevent trace contaminants, these thin-film support windows are available in various formats, including rolls (continuous and perforated), pre-cut sheets, or supported in a card frame for easy application. A wide range of window materials is currently available in various thicknesses for sample containment, such as Polypropylene, Kapton, and Mylar®. Thicker films offer greater durability but attenuate X-ray signals more strongly.
